Popular places to visit
Gloucester Cathedral
4.5/5(93 reviews)
Home to the tomb of King Edward II, this magnificent 1,300-year-old cathedral was also a filming location for the Harry Potter movies.
Gloucester Docks
4.5/5(124 reviews)
Once a thriving maritime port, this urban redevelopment is now a buzzing district of fashion outlets, riverside restaurants, museums and a working boatyard.
Gloucester Waterways Museum
Play around with interactive exhibits, study educational displays and examine an extensive collection of boats at this quayside museum.
